WebJun 22, 2024 · Robin Nest Construction. In a robin couple, a male brings his female partner nesting material as she constructs the robins’ nest. The female builds the cup-like nest with mud as its foundation and lines it with grasses, twigs and other plant material before laying bright blue robin eggs. “I’ve watched American robins start building nests. WebJul 30, 2024 · Given their habitat, the Indian robin includes amphibians and reptiles into their diets. They tend to single out frogs and lizards for a successful meal option. These birds also eat a variety of insects. Interestingly, this species consumes little fruit. With such harsh habitats, protein helps them to thrive.
